Peg Herring

Biography

Peg Herring is the author of the critically acclaimed Simon & Elizabeth Mysteries as well as the popular Dead Detective Mysteries. She lives in northern Michigan with her husband of many decades. In addition to reading and writing, she enjoys music, travel, and--um--reading and writing.

Macbeth's Niece

Tessa macFindlaech is sent to her uncle's castle to learn proper behavior, but events soon change her fate. Captured by an English spy, she's thrust into a different world, where she must stand up for herself and ignore her stubborn Highland heart.
